We are seeking a dynamic and experienced Senior Community Physiotherapist to join our dedicated team at the Carlisle and District ICC. This role offers a unique opportunity to contribute to a service that is essential in providing admission prevention, supported discharge, specialist assessment, and rehabilitation for patients experiencing a variety of long and short-term conditions.
This position is available now and the pay rate for this role will be up to £27 per hour.
Main responsibilities of this Physiotherapy vacancy:
- Deliver comprehensive physiotherapy services including assessment, treatment, and management of patients within the community setting.
- Work collaboratively with health and social care professionals to offer integrated care and advice.
- Support the flow and discharge processes in close coordination with Brampton Community Hospital.
- Implement patient-centered care plans, focusing on improving quality of life and promoting independence.
- Participate in multidisciplinary team meetings and contribute to service development.
Essential requirements of this Physiotherapy vacancy:
- Degree in Physiotherapy or equivalent.
- Registration with the Health and Care Professions Council (HCPC).
- Proven experience in a community physiotherapy setting.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
